Jerry Gaskill is the drummer of long-running progressive metal stalwarts King's X. His single solo effort thus far, 2004's Come Somewhere, tends more towards the lighter side of his main group's sound. Mahogany Rush is a Canadian rock band led by guitarist Frank Marino. Tiles is a progressive rock band formed in Detroit, Michigan, USA in February 1993.
